Horry-Georgetown Technical College (HGTC) Alpha Nu Sigma Chapter Members and Advisors received International Awards at the Phi Theta Kappa Catalyst April 7-9, 2022 in Denver, Colorado. The HGTC Alpha Nu Sigma Chapter received the Distinguished College Project Award (1 of only 50 awarded) and Top 100 Chapter Award out of over 1,200 in the world.

Phi Theta Kappa partnered with the National Junior College Athletic Association Esports (NJCAAE) to host an esports competition during Catalyst this year. Nicholas Papotto, HGTC Alpha Nu Sigma Chapter member, was on the winning esports team. He and his team members received a $250 scholarship, a personalized NJCAAE jersey, and $300 worth of Alienware peripherals and were recognized on stage during the Hallmark Awards gala.

“I am proud of the leadership skills our students are gaining through our HGTC Alpha Nu Sigma Chapter. The real-world experiences will be a game changer in their lives. I appreciate the tenacity of the advisors in bringing students to such great heights,” said Dr. Marilyn Murphy Fore, HGTC President.
